共查询到18条相似文献,搜索用时 125 毫秒
1.
基于驱动程序的协议栈设计 总被引:2,自引:0,他引:2
提出了一种新的协议栈设计思路———基于驱动程序的协议栈设计。在对比传统的协议栈设计方式———基于任务的协议栈设计的基础上 ,说明了其优点为可减少实时操作系统保存和恢复任务上下文的次数、数据和控制信息更简单的在层与层之间传输 ,给出了协议栈设计的基本框架。 相似文献
2.
提出一种新的协议栈设计思路&&基于驱动程序的协议栈设计,在对比传统的协议栈设计方式&&基于任务的协议栈设计的基础上,说明了此种方法的优势所在,并给出了协议栈设计的基本框架 相似文献
3.
4.
5.
USB已经成为一种非常成功的总线标准。以USB在一个嵌入式系统的实现案例,介绍了USB总线的硬件研发过程及相关USB协议栈的设计与实现,并且探讨了在嵌入式操作系统中基于该协议栈的USB设备驱动的开发以及USB Bios Boot Rom的设计。 相似文献
6.
项思远 《数字社区&智能家居》2007,(10):100-101
讨论了一个适合嵌入式系统TCP/IP协议栈的设计思想,实现技术以及应用,关键性技术是如何裁减标准TCP/IP协议栈以适应嵌入式系统的特点而又要保证该协议栈可以和标准协议栈正常通讯。 相似文献
7.
SIP(Session Initiation Protocol,会话初始化协议)是由IETF(Internet工程任务组)提出的应用层控制协议,目的是在不同网络架构中建立IP信令连接.本文简要介绍了会话初始协议的应用概况,分析了协议的结构,设计了一个基于C 的,采用分层结构实现的SIP协议栈,并详细介绍了事务层的实现方案. 相似文献
8.
PictBridge是数码照相设备和打印机通信的协议。文章研究了该协议三个层次的相互通信方式以及该协议架构针对嵌入式系统的软件实现和优化方法。通过适当地隔离协议软件的三个不同层次,简化了系统状态机,解决了各个层次的协议软件的同步问题。 相似文献
9.
陈华鹏 《计算机应用与软件》2008,25(9)
嵌入式设备传输彩信依靠嵌入式MMS(Multimedia Messaging Service)协议栈.阐述了移动彩信的实现机制,给出了一个在嵌入式设备中设计和实现简易MMS协议栈的解决方案.经在安防设备开发中使用,证明本嵌入式协议栈可以通过现有移动电话网传送实时信息. 相似文献
10.
项思远 《数字社区&智能家居》2007,(19)
讨论了一个适合嵌入式系统TCP/IP协议栈的设计思想.实现技术以及应用,关键性技术是如何裁减标准TCP/IP协议栈以适应嵌入式系统的特点而又要保证该协议栈可以和标准协议栈正常通讯. 相似文献
11.
论述了RTEMS操作系统的内核结构,分析和介绍了在RTEMS操作系统下设备驱动开发的基本方法. 相似文献
12.
RTEMS是一款优秀的实时嵌入式操作系统,它支持多种处理器架构,具有良好的可移植性和裁剪性,支持多种API标准以及开源的特点使得它被广泛地应用在多种嵌入式领域。以基于SPARC V8架构的SAILING S698处理器开发板为目标,分析了RTEMS移植到S698的主要过程,介绍了RTEMS移植的开发环境配置,描述了在配置好的环境下板支持包(BSP)的开发详细步骤。 相似文献
13.
为实现不同现场总线之间的通信和提供统一的设计模式,达到屏蔽现场总线异构性的目的,对多种现场总线集成环境下不同总线之间的通信进行了研究,建立协议栈模型实现了协议转换网关的通用化设计。与传统的协议转换方式相比,不再局限于一对一的转换,具有与对象位置、通信协议的无关性,提高了系统的扩展性和对不同总线的兼容性。 相似文献
14.
为实现不同现场总线之间的通信和提供统一的设计模式,达到屏蔽现场总线异构性的目的,对多种现场总线集成环境下不同总线之间的通信进行了研究,建立协议栈模型实现了协议转换网关的通用化设计。与传统的协议转换方式相比,不再局限于一对一的转换,具有与对象位置、通信协议的无关性,提高了系统的扩展性和对不同总线的兼容性。 相似文献
15.
Intel提出的第三代总线技术PCI Express在结构上可以满足计算机系统的发展对总线带宽的要求,基于PCIE的设计得以蓬勃发展,对PCIE的验证也成为SoC功能验证的重要组成部分。为此,设计并实现一种状态图和覆盖率组合驱动的自动化验证平台,主要包括激励生成、自动检测和覆盖率分析机制,并将其应用于一款基于PCIE接口的协议栈芯片的功能验证。实验结果表明,该验证平台具有较好的激励生成机制,能够对协议栈芯片进行全面验证,同时具有较好的复用性、可扩展性,可以对多个协议栈的互连进行验证。 相似文献
16.
USB已经成为一种事实上的I/O标准,本文以自主开发的基于ISA总线的USB为例,介绍了该USB的硬件研发过程及相关系统软件的开发过程,详尽地展示了相关USB协议栈的设计与实现,并且探讨了USB设备基于该协议栈的驱动开发. 相似文献
17.
网络协议栈虚拟化的目标是在一台网络设备上虚拟出多个协议栈以实现网络设备的一虚多功能。由于 Linux操作系统的网络协议栈本身是不支持这种网络协议栈虚拟化技术的,因此本文通过对Linux操作系统3.11.10版本 IPV4网络协议栈进行改造以实现 Linux网络协议栈的虚拟化,并在设备平台上验证了经过网络协议栈虚拟化改造后的以太网交换机对业务流的隔离功能。 相似文献
18.
Epilogue和BSD协议栈的实现机制的比较 总被引:2,自引:1,他引:2
协议栈是网络通信中最重要的软件部分,在数据交换中起着重要作用。对其进行研究分析有助于进行特定情况下的协议栈实现。文中对两种典型协议栈的实现方式进行比较,分析了两者在各个层次上的协议的实现,并比较其协议栈所占用资源,从而对其可靠性和进行二次开发的可能性进行研究,最后分析了这两种协议栈的实现方式的优缺点。两种协议栈的比较可为实现某种协议栈时提高其可靠性、可读性、可移植性提供有益参考。 相似文献